> Simultaneous-Use indeed would block user from connecting via Router1 and =
Router2 at the same time, but nothing stops him to use Router1 OR Router2.
> Imagine situation, where user "A" supposed to connect to Router1's SSID, =
but instead, he chooses SSID from Router2, and still he will be authorized =
by freeradius. How can i block this kind of access. I want the user to conn=
ect only via Router1, and take away the possibility for him to connect via =
Router2.

  Put the users into groups.  Then, check the group membership against the =
router they=92re using.

  See rlm_passwd for simple Unix-style groups.
